Performance by singer-songwriter, pianist Sarah Perrotta ’02 to kick off Alumni Reunion Weekend, Oct. 14

Singer-songwriter, pianist and SUNY New Paltz alumna Sarah Perrotta ’02 (Jazz Studies) and her band (including a string quartet!) will kick off Alumni Reunion Weekend with a special performance on Oct. 14, 2022, in Studley Theatre at 7:30 p.m.

The string arrangements were scored by prominent Italian film composer Enzo DeRosa and were used for Perrotta’s latest album Blue to Gold, produced by world-renowned drummer Jerry Marotta (of Peter Gabriel, Hall & Oates, Sarah McLachlan).

“My studies at New Paltz gave me a strong foundation that I have built my life off of,” said Perrotta. “I’ll never forget it and I’m so happy to be playing a concert at the great Studley Theatre where I have so many wonderful memories.”

Tickets are $10 at the door and free for SUNY New Paltz students. The event is open to the public and kicks off the Music Department’s Fall Concert Series.

Born into a musical family, Perrotta has been singing and composing music since early childhood. She studied classical piano, participated in several bands in high school and toured European cathedrals and concert halls with a choir at the age of 15.

After earning her degree at New Paltz, she released her debut album “Drink the Sky” with her acclaimed indie band Outloud Dreamer (a duo with bassist/producer Carl Adami) when she was 19.

“The jazz program at New Paltz really felt like a family to me,” said Perrotta. “It was a small program with only about 25 jazz studies majors while I was there. We got into the music so deeply and were truly supported and inspired by our professors and each other.
